A lot of people in the market are
offering cabinet-less displays at substantially reduced prices. Let us
understand what is a cabinet-less display, Cabinet-less displays are nothing but
LED modules without any metal framings. These #modules are generally installed
directly on #plywood. As it doesn’t involve any structure it is offered at a
cheaper cost but the #product #design itself is faulty. Hence, these #displays
have a long term con, which opens lots of loopholes that can possess #safety and
quality issues in the future.
Wherein LED Displays with cabinet
design have properly framed cabinet from behind that encapsulates all the #wires, #chips, etc. All of the issues and risks faced by Cabinet-less Display
are eradicated in the LED with Cabinet design.
7 important reasons to understand
why you should not choose Cabinet less display over LED with cabinet Design.
#Alignment:
Cabinet-less LED displays are
installed on #handmade structure hence the precision of the structure affects
the final alignment for cabinet less screen. In MS cabinets there are
interlocks and module positioning holes that can help achieve good alignment. XM
Die cast cabinets being completely #machine-made have the highest precision with
auto fit module #mechanism which eliminates the need for the #engineer to do any
adjustments for alignment.
#Flatness:
The flatness of the #screen
provides a #seamless feel to an LED display. A complete flat screen can be
achieved through an auto fit module mechanism. With Xtreme Media’s Vega series
a very high cabinet precision can be achieved within hours. Vega series
contains die-cast #Aluminium material which not only makes the cabinet precision
accurate but also makes it faster. This is difficult and time-consuming to
achieve with mild #steel (MS) cabinets, which are generally used in any LED #video #wall. It is nearly impossible to achieve with cabinet less LED screens
due to the inherent unevenness of the #metal back frame.
#Fire #Hazard:
Cabinet less design not only
affects the aesthetics of LED video walls but also poses safety threats. Since
the #power #supplies and cables are directly #mounted on the plywood, any short #circuit in the #system will cause a fire hazard. In MS and die-cast cabinet
design each cabinet has an #electrical #terminal #block. In the case of any short
circuit, this internal terminal block is first affected and the power to the
cabinet is disconnected. This ensures there are no fire escalated or safety
hazards present.
Quality Control:
Cabinet less design is nothing,
but modules directly installed without any #framework, the various components in
the cabinet less screen do not go through quality control tests. Failure points
like faulty modules, #power #supplies, #cables, #controllers, etc. can be
encountered only when the complete screen is installed at the client location.
These leaves a high margin of errors on-site and the overall installation time
and #output could go haywire.
Exposed To #Rodents, #Dust, And
Insects:
While installing cabinet less LED
video wall there is an open space between the plywood and the modules which carry
a risk of being exposed to #rats, #insects, etc. This increases the chance of
wires/cables being cut off and resulting in a short circuit. Over time, dust
can accumulate inside the power supplies resulting in increased failures.
Xtreme Media’s Vega or Kore series cabinets are properly framed eliminating all
these risks.
#Thermal #Management:
The aluminium body of die-cast
cabinet enables faster dissipation of #heat through the entire body. Even
mild-steel provides a decent scope to create ventilation that can manage the
heat created but this is not at all possible in the cabinet less design.
#BIS And #Safety #Certificates:
The quality and safety
certifications are provided for cabinets such as MS and die-cast and not for
modules. Having no certification for modules increases the chances of
unqualified products being sold to customers which possess serious #quality
problems, electrical and fire safety risks for the #customers.
